We buy more and more clothing and use it less and less. These garments, commonly known as “fast fashion” or “ultra fast fashion”, are produced in countries with much more lax social and environmental legislation than those in Europe. 

This idea constitutes the starting point of the temporary exhibition Dialogue in the key of Slow Fashion organized on the occasion of the Sustainable Fashion days that take place in the Museum of Costume on April 5 and 6, 2019. 

The exhibition presents the proposals and solutions that many companies dedicated to the fashion industry are developing in response to the great challenges posed by the rapid purchase system. A widely used procedure that, unfortunately, each view brings less value to the product. Added to this are the terrible environmental effects, especially in the use of resources such as water or the generation of toxic waste, which contribute to the climate change produced by these industrial clothing techniques. 

The new companies of the 21st century are those that make these challenges their own and integrate into their business models proposals that provide social, environmental and economic values for all, and especially for future generations.
